Entry from: Ganden Monastery, China Entry Title: "3 Days Solo Trek, Ganden to Samye Monastery" Entry: "In Ganden, walking the lower kora (pilgrimage walk) behind the monastery, I ran into a Tibetan sky burial site. This is were a specially chosen Tibetan monk takes a corpse, lays it out on a mountain top, and chops the flesh to pieces with a knife to attract vultures to eat the flesh off the corpse. Once the body has been picked to bones, the monk crushes the bones and mixes it with meal to again attract vultures. I've read differing accounts and talked with one American who witnessed a sky burial last month in Litang. Though I didn't have the opportunity to witness a sky burial, just seeing the site with discarded clothing, human hair, and abandoned knives and hammers was an experience I'll never forget. After a day of wandering around Ganden monastery, I headed out on what I figured would be a four or five day solo trek across a couple 5000+ meter passes to Samye Monastery. Most hire yaks, yak herders and a guide and some even hire a cook. I didn't quite see the need for all that so I set off by myself. I can't even begin to describe how moved I was walking alone through glacial Himalayan valleys. I can't say as I was really alone.
